What is a Private Online Psychiatrist?
A private online psychiatrist is a certified mental health professional who provides psychiatric evaluations, diagnosis, and treatment through digital platforms such as video calls, telephone call, or safe and secure messaging services. This technique allows clients to get care from the convenience of their homes, conquering geographical barriers and minimizing the preconception that can include visiting a psychiatric workplace.
Advantages of Private Online Psychiatry
Ease of access: Online psychiatrists make mental health assistance more accessible, especially for those residing in rural or underserved locations.
Convenience: Busy schedules can make it difficult for people to find time for in-person consultations. Online services enable clients to choose times that match their programs.
Anonymity: Many individuals feel more comfortable talking about mental health issues from the privacy of their homes. This typically results in more open interaction between patient and psychiatrist.
Comprehensive Care: Online psychiatrists can provide various services, consisting of medication management, therapy sessions, and constant follow-ups.
Screening and Resources: With online services, it's typically easier for psychiatrists to share resources, tests, and screening tools that can benefit patients.

Picking the right online psychiatrist can be a daunting procedure. To make sure the best possible fit, consider the following actions:
Check Credentials: Verify that the psychiatrist is licensed and board-certified.
Check out Reviews: Look for evaluations or testimonials from previous patients to gauge their experiences.
Evaluate Specializations: Choose a psychiatrist who specializes in your particular mental health condition.
Consider Accessibility: Check the psychiatrist's accessibility and whether it aligns with your schedule.
Examine Communication Style: Some people choose a more instruction technique, while others gain from a supportive, understanding design. Choose based upon what feels right for you.
Tips for a Successful Online Psychiatry Experience
Make Sure a Quiet Space: Find a private and quiet environment for your sessions to reduce distractions.
Prepare for Sessions: Write down your thoughts and any questions in advance to make the most out of your appointment.
Be Honest: Openly discuss your feelings, symptoms, and history for precise diagnosis and reliable treatment.
Follow Up: If you have concerns or experience adverse effects from medications, interact with your psychiatrist quickly.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Will my online psychiatrist prescribe medication?
Yes, many private online psychiatrists have the authority to prescribe medication. Nevertheless, this will depend upon a preliminary examination to identify the need for medicinal intervention.
2. Is online therapy as reliable as in-person therapy?
Research reveals that online therapy can be as efficient as in-person treatment, especially for particular conditions such as anxiety and anxiety.
3. How do I guarantee my online sessions are safe?
Credible online psychiatry services use encrypted platforms to safeguard patient details. Always examine the psychiatrist's personal privacy policy before beginning sessions.
4. Do I require insurance to see a private online psychiatrist?
While some psychiatrists accept insurance, numerous also offer self-pay alternatives. Confirm payment methods during your preliminary inquiry.
5. Can I change psychiatrists if I feel it's not a great fit?
Definitely. It's essential to feel comfy with your psychiatrist. If you don't believe they fulfill your needs, think about finding somebody else.
